WINTXCODERS

Programación => Desarrollo web => Mensaje iniciado por: DeiivisBs en Junio 23, 2020, 06:27:34 pm

Título: [SMF] Personalizar estadísticas.
Publicado por: DeiivisBs en Junio 23, 2020, 06:27:34 pm
Hola comunidad de WTX, En esta oportunidad les enseñare a como personalizar las estadísticas de vuestro foro [SMF].

Resultado a conseguir
(https://i.imgur.com/ROXgaE2.png)

En vuestro BoardIndex.template.php deben buscar el respectivo apartado donde quieren añadir las estadísticas, el código a pegar es el siguiente:

Código:
Para poder ver los links necesitas estar registrado - [• Registrarse •] [• Iniciar Sesión •]
Show some statistics if stat info is off.
echo '
<div id="index_common_stats">
<div class="posts">
<i class="fa fa-comments"></i>
<h2>', $txt['posts_made'], '</h2>
<span class="stat">
', $context['common_stats']['total_posts'], '
</span>
</div>
<div class="topics">
<i class="fa fa-comment"></i>
<h2>', $txt['topics'], '</h2>
<span class="stat">
', $context['common_stats']['total_topics'], '
</span>
</div>
<div class="members">
<i class="fa fa-users"></i>
<h2>', $txt['members'], '</h2>
<span class="stat">
', $context['common_stats']['total_members'], '
</span>
</div>
<div class="last_member">
<i class="fa fa-user"></i>
<h2>', $txt['welcome_member'], '</h2>
<span class="stat">
', $context['common_stats']['latest_member']['link'], '
</span>
</div>
</div>';


En vuestro index.css deben pegar el siguiente codigo:
Código:
Para poder ver los links necesitas estar registrado - [• Registrarse •] [• Iniciar Sesión •]
/* Custom Stats */
#index_common_stats {
float: none;
position: static;
text-align: inherit;
display: flex;
justify-content: center;
margin: 10px 0;
}
#index_common_stats div {
flex-basis: 20%;
text-align: left;
background-color: #fff;
border-radius: 4px;
box-shadow: 2px 3px 0px 1px rgba(0, 0, 0, 0.2);
border: 1px solid rgba(0, 0, 0, 0.05);
margin: 0 5px;
padding: 20px 15px 15px;
color: #646464;
}
#index_common_stats div i {
position: absolute;
margin-top: -36px;
font-size: 10pt;
display: block;
padding: 10px;
border-radius: 100%;
background-color: #F75353;
color: #fff;
}
#index_common_stats div h2 {
text-transform: uppercase;
font-size: 10pt;
display: block;
margin: 5px 0 2px;
}
#index_common_stats div span {
font-size: 18pt;
line-height: 25px;
}
#index_common_stats div.topics i {
background-color: #51D466;
}
#index_common_stats div.members i {
background-color: #32C8DE;
}
#index_common_stats div.last_member i {
background-color: #F78153;
}